A Face a Mother, and Pretty Much Everyone Else, Can Love
San Diego, CA (July 28, 2005)
Meet Bocce, an orphaned walrus calf rescued from Kivalina, Alaska last month. Found on a Chukchi Sea beach, the 100-pound baby walrus was flown to the Alaska SeaLife Center in Seward where she was found to be mildly dehydrated. Since officials knew she would be unable to survive on her own, they decided to send her here, to SeaWorld San Diego. Today Bocce weighs more than 120 pounds and measures about five feet in length. She is bottle fed by the Wild Arctic team, who also provide her companionship, and some pool and play time. It is hoped that Bocce may soon be introduced to Tessa, our previously rescued walrus pup, and eventually the other walrus at Wild Arctic.
